How they compare
Namibia currently reports 652.74 million current US$ against 454.21 million current US$ in Mozambique, a difference of 198.54 million current US$.
That makes Namibia's figure about 1.4 times Mozambique's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 24 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Mozambique ahead.
Mozambique ranks 12th and Namibia ranks 11th of 23 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Mozambique averaged higher in 2 and Namibia in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Mozambique | Namibia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 246.93 million current US$ | 137.53 million current US$ | 109.40 million current US$ | Mozambique |
| 1990s | 247.75 million current US$ | 368.42 million current US$ | 120.67 million current US$ | Namibia |
| 2000s | 459.32 million current US$ | 385.60 million current US$ | 73.72 million current US$ | Mozambique |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Taxes are compulsory, unrequited payments made by institutional units to government units. Indirect taxes consists of ‘taxes on products’ payable on goods and services when they are produced, delivered, sold, transferred or otherwise disposed by their producers, plus ‘other taxes on production’.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
